The Synopsis

The Super 8mm film “Muñecos” (1972) — shot by the artist, Leopoldo Maler and Carolee Schneemann — combines recordings of a happening by Hirsch that took place in three cities: in Buenos Aires, London, and New York. In each, she is seen handing out 500 tiny baby dolls to bystanders, while candidly suggesting to everyone: “Have a baby!” This work was made in response to a period of strong pro-natalist and anti-contraceptive policies pushed by the Argentinian government.
